Output 82563068dcec1bc682d5ab5a2e9b7ab42a6335b183808c1e62ea492ab17efb63:0

value
2129795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d58727d29f29ebac289b6976e84c5c85db6c7a33 OP_EQUAL
address
3MA3mBBgTNzJnsXZx4Xn4KnDqJJ3haX8iN
transaction
82563068dcec1bc682d5ab5a2e9b7ab42a6335b183808c1e62ea492ab17efb63